What does a Senior Internal Audit Controls Analyst do at Swire Coca-Cola?

As a Senior Internal Audit Controls Analyst at Swire Coca-Cola, USA, you will play a key role in strengthening and evolving the company's internal control environment. Partnering closely with leaders across Finance, Internal Audit, IT, Operations, and other business functions, you will evaluate end-to-end processes, identify risks and control gaps, and implement practical, sustainable solutions that support compliance, operational excellence, and business performance. You will lead efforts to develop and maintain corporate policies, standard operating procedures (SOPs), Risk & Control Matrices (RCMs), and governance documentation while helping integrate effective controls into business processes, organizational change initiatives, and continuous improvement efforts. This role serves as a resource to business stakeholders on internal controls and governance practices and helps drive the adoption of scalable, sustainable solutions that support long-term business success.

Due to the nature of our work and to help maintain a safe workplace for our employees and customers, after a candidate receives a conditional offer of employment, they will be required to complete pre-employment screening. This includes a criminal background check, drug screening, and for certain roles, a motor vehicle record review.

Screening results are evaluated based on several factors, including the nature and severity of an offense, how much time has passed, the relevance to the position, patterns of repeated offenses, and driving history for roles that require operating a vehicle.

All results are reviewed fairly and in accordance with applicable state and federal laws, including the Fair Credit Reporting Act.
